WebThese are classified into four types: Series Wound. Shunt Wound. Compound Wound. Permanent Magnet. In the series wound DC motors, the rotor winding is connected in series with the field winding. Varying the supply voltage will help in controlling the speed. These are used in lifts, cranes, and hoists, etc. WebHá 1 hora · Advertisement. Web11 de jan. de 2024 · They are generally classified according to their means of generating a magnetic field. Separately excited motors have magnetic poles energized by an external source. In contrast, the magnetic poles are energized by the motor itself in a self-excited (also sometimes called non-excited and directly excited) machine.

WebClass I, Division 1 motors Motors for use in environments deemed Class I, Divi-sion 1 must be built and labeled as explosion-proof. An explosion-proof motor has several important characteristics. First, the motor must be constructed in such a way that it will be able to completely contain an internal explosion without rupturing.
